National Museum of Panchevo, Cultural institution in Pančevo, Serbia
The National Museum of Panchevo is a museum in the South Banat District that displays regional art, historical objects, and collections. The neoclassical building houses exhibitions about local history and the development of the area.
The museum was founded in 1923 and has occupied the former city hall building since then. Since its opening, it has collected and preserved objects that document how Panchevo and the surrounding area developed over time.
The museum displays artworks by regional artists and objects that reflect the coexistence of different communities in South Banat. Visitors can see how local customs and traditions were shaped by various influences and evolved over time.

The museum preserves objects that tell the industrial story of Panchevo, including materials from a historic brewery. These collections show how factories and manufacturing shaped the city and defined its economic life.
